dc.description.abstract Water is a crucial component for the existence of all forms of lifecycles. The availability of fresh water for mankind consumption and for cultural and social needs is becoming scarcer rapidly. Water scarcity is hitting the globe along with Pakistan. Arid and semi-arid areas of the world are facing water scarcity issues. To overcome the alarming situation of water scarcity, grey water management is gaining importance in order to reuse it as alternative for fresh water for various purposes. This project deals with the recycling of greywater and its reuse as it is the best option to reduce water shortage in a sustainable manner. Main objective of this project is to design a sustainable and cost-efficient greywater recycling plant for a house, to treat greywater generated from a house and recommended to reuse it for the purposes of cleaning, garden watering and toilet flushing. This plant has designed with the main aim of solving water scarcity problem and increased water demand that is prevailing in Pakistan. The analysis of greywater, design procedure and economic analysis of greywater recycling plant is covered in this project along with the project benefits in accordance to national needs.
